Best Union Bridge Public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 1,384 students in Union Bridge, MD.
The top ranked public schools in Union Bridge, MD are Francis Scott Key High School and Elmer A. Wolfe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Union Bridge, MD public schools have an average math proficiency score of 35% (versus the Maryland public school average of 19%), and reading proficiency score of 48% (versus the 36% statewide average). Schools in Union Bridge have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Maryland public schools.
Minority enrollment is 14%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Maryland public school average of 66% (majority Black).
